The project’s scope as described in Contract Documents is:

 

This project will provide safer access to SR305 with the construction of a roundabout at the new intersection of Johnson Road and a non-motorized crossing at SR305. The project will include roadway, illumination, sidewalk, and shared use path improvements in various configurations. Stormwater conveyance improvements will be included. Utility relocation/replacement will occur as needed. New water/sewer mains will be installed in the new roadway segment.
